Guide to RFID Software

RFID software enables supply chains and warehouses to comply with government standards

By Stephanie Feaman


Radio frequency identification devices (RFID) that include readers, writers and printers transmit and receive data that is processed by RFID software. This software is available in a variety of applications that make it possible to create RFID tags and RFID labels that are in compliance with the electronic product code (EPC) as well as the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D) standards.

RFID software is often used by supply chains and warehouses as these applications produce global trade identification numbers (GTIN), serialized global trade identification numbers (SGTIN) and serialized shipping container codes (SSCC). Determine if web-based RFID software applications are a good fit for your company

Web-based RFID software allows for mobility, flexibility and easy upgrades to keep up with rapid technological advances. These applications are often available for a reasonable cost and the tools are user friendly.
